The Alternative Limb Project by Sophie de Oliveira Barata is where art meets science

Creative Boom

She didn't get to see many clients, although a few clients did come to the clinic to see the prosthetist – the person who rehabilitates, creates and fits prostheses for people requiring artificial limb replacements. The client is very much involved in the process. They would send us information.
